About Concord CLM's Integration
What kind of authentication does Concord CLM use?
Concord CLM uses OAuth.
Do I need a paid Concord CLM account to use Concord CLM with Zapier?
You need a Pro or Enterprise Concord CLM plan to use Concord CLM with Zapier.
Do I need special account permissions in Concord CLM to use Concord CLM with Zapier?
There aren't any specific Concord CLM account permissions to connect Concord CLM to Zapier.
But, to use the Create a New Document from a Template action, you must have permission to create documents in Concord CLM. Triggers can be used with any documents you have access to.
Are there any API token limits in Concord CLM when I use Concord CLM with Zapier?
No, there are no token limits when using Concord CLM with Zapier.
Are there any webhook subscription limits in Concord CLM when I use Concord CLM with Zapier?
Concord CLM doesn't have any webhook subscription limits when you use Concord CLM with Zapier.
Are custom fields in Concord CLM supported when I use Concord CLM with Zapier?
Yes, Concord CLM supports custom fields.
Does Concord CLM use real trigger samples from my Concord CLM account?
No, Concord CLM does not provide real trigger samples from your Concord CLM account. Only generic samples are provided.
What kind of Concord CLM hosted account can I use with Zapier?
Concord CLM's Zapier integration supports cloud-hosted accounts only.
Connecting with Concord CLM
When you create a Concord CLM Zap, you'll be asked to log in to your Concord CLM account (unless you are already logged in).
Finally, you will be asked to give Zapier permission to access your account. Click Connect to continue.
If all steps were successful, your Concord CLM account will be connected.
